Output ef96ed17783dc6bfb0fb421440873ca4a2d0510b2e18c2ef5e7b080bb63503bf:0

value
4136
script pubkey
OP_0 OP_PUSHBYTES_20 963eaa326d07fc215928889033a779a7307984e2
address
bc1qjcl25vndql7zzkfg3zgr8fme5uc8np8z0avnl6
transaction
ef96ed17783dc6bfb0fb421440873ca4a2d0510b2e18c2ef5e7b080bb63503bf
confirmations
70821
spent
true